Output 20fcbc74b26f4f3a8c97245bd0480fbdaa1528be4c827787a7739c71cac65c68:6

value
10943994
script pubkey
OP_0 OP_PUSHBYTES_20 59082c5a099f8ed18c19d1a20fa89f6afb98244d
address
bc1qtyyzcksfn78drrqe6x3ql2yldtaesfzd9w4972
transaction
20fcbc74b26f4f3a8c97245bd0480fbdaa1528be4c827787a7739c71cac65c68